The Background Suppression Sensor is optimized for precise detection of PCBs, achieving a detection range between 20 and 50 mm. It incorporates a modulated visible red light source at 640 nm and features two distinct light spots, positioned 11 mm apart, each with a size of 4 mm at a distance of 50 mm. The sensor is designed to operate effectively under ambient light conditions as specified in EN 60947-5-2.
With a miniature housing of dimensions 31 mm (height) x 23 mm (width) x 11 mm (depth) and a mass of approximately 50 g, this device is constructed from glass-fiber-reinforced Makrolon for the housing and PMMA for the optical face. It is rated with an IP67 protection class, ensuring reliability in various environments.
Electrical specifications include a wide operating voltage range of 10 to 30 V DC, a maximum no-load current of 15 mA, and an output switching type configured for dark-on operation. The sensor's NPN output is short-circuit and reverse polarity protected, capable of handling switching voltages up to 30 V DC and currents up to 100 mA, with a response time of just 1 ms and a switching frequency of 500 Hz.
Functional safety metrics indicate an MTTFd of 794 years and a mission time of 20 years, providing a high level of operational reliability. The device is equipped with two yellow LEDs as function indicators to signify detection status.
